Source: Alar: Kannada-English corpusGhīḷiḍisu (ಘೀಳಿಡಿಸು):—
1) [verb] to cause (an elephant) to utter its characteristic sound.
2) [verb] to make (someone or something) cry in that manner; to cause to scream (from fear, pain, etc.).
3) [verb] (fig.) to punish, chastise.
